Provision of a Safe Haven (Day Time Support) and 24/7 Telephone Crisis Line Service on behalf of NHS Stockport CCG

NHS Stockport Clinical Commissioning Group (CCG) are inviting suitably qualified and experienced healthcare providers to submit tenders for the provision of a 24/7 Mental Health Crisis Pathway for the people of Stockport.

This is a new service that is designed to complement rather than replace or supersede existing local provision and will include a Safe Haven (day time support) and 24/7 Telephone Crisis Line.

The service aims to meet the needs of people experiencing acute emotional distress associated with a mental health problem (which may or may not have been given a formal diagnosis). The service will operate from a central location within Stockport to be identified by the successful provider.

There are 2 key purposes: to provide a safe, welcoming and comfortable place for people in immediate acute emotional distress and for those seeking to prevent the onset of a crisis and to work with the individuals to create plans and strategies for managing their mental health and well-being and preventing future crisis.

The service requires the successful provider to work in an innovative way with partners across all sectors to provide a service that is easy to access at times of need.

The service is focussed on supporting episodes of emotional distress; it is not designed to be ongoing support intervention. However, it is recognised that there will be a cohort of service users who may access the service a number of times; seeking ongoing support and input. The service would be expected to work with these individuals to transition them to more suitable universal support and services.

The contract duration will be for 3 years from 1.4.2020, with an option to extend for a further 2 years at the discretion of the CCG. The CCG has an annual budget of up to 300 000 GBP per annum.
